Historical Sortino Ratio

The chart shows GLDB's rolling Sortino ratio over time compared to your chosen benchmark. Rising trends indicate improving returns relative to downside risk, while declining trends may signal deteriorating risk-adjusted performance or increased volatility during market stress. Use multiple timeframes to distinguish short-term fluctuations from long-term patterns.

Identify market cycles by observing when GLDB consistently outperforms (line above benchmark), underperforms (below benchmark), or aligns with the benchmark.
